i want to buy 2 new rescue clubs i currently have a benross 22 deg which i hit around 190yds and im verry happy with it but its tired and very battered.
so i was thinking about getting a 17-19deg my thinking is gives me a club to use of the tee where there is danger within driver range but i also need a club that i can use from the fairway to give me a shot at some eagles on par 5s :D
ive also been thinking of getting a 26-28deg to replace my 4-5 iron as i lack confidence with my long irons and my shots can be very erratic and generally lay up which obviously costs me alot of shots

is my thinking sound? can this kind of set up work? i would appreciate your advice or even some other suggestions thanks

You can have as many rescues as you like. They only thing I would say is the 17-19 degree one is very similar in loft to your 5 wood so maybe something about 21/22 degrees and then the 25 or so might be a better spread.

I'm currently carrying 3 rescue clubs, 15* 19* and 22* as well as a 4 Iron (lob wedge removed) as I find the 4 Iron much easier to hit off the current tight (burnt) fairways. The rescues do come in to their own when the fairways are lusher or slightly longer and the ball sits up a bit as well as from the semi and rough. Could be just my swing but this make up has been working well for me. I'm also hitting the 15* rescue a mile off the tee at the moment instead of a 3 wood :D

Keep in mind that you will get further distance from your 5 wood than from a simliar loft rescue club, as teh wood has a longer shaft.

I am a hybrid fan ( although I use long irons) and definately support teh idea that each player should put whatever they feel comfortable with in their bag. Forget what the other guy has....

As you've had a wrist injury, the hybrids are a good option as they are more about sweeping the ball off the turf than taking a divot as you would with irons. That should be a less stressful impact on the wrists. Good luck.
